Springfield, MO
Owner/developer: Triple S. Properties Inc. and Morelock Builders and Associates Inc.
General contractor: Morelock Builders and Associates
Architect: H Design Group LLC
Engineers: CJW Transportation Consultants, civil; Pinnacle Design Consultants, structural; CJD Engineering LLC, mechanical, electrical and plumbing
Size: 73,000 square feet
Estimated cost: $10 million
Lender: Regent Bank
Estimated completion: June
Project description: A 55 and older community is underway on 9 acres a mile east of the U.S. Highway 65 and State Highway CC interchange in Ozark. Development partners Triple S. Properties and Morelock Builders and Associates are creating 47 living units, each with all brick exteriors, attached garages and covered porches. Dana Neeley-Smith, who handles marketing for Morelock Builders, said one-bedroom units are 1,300 square feet and two-bedroom units are 2,050-square-foot. Lease rates are undetermined, but she said two- and three-year leases come with a social membership to Fremont Hills Country Club for one year. Fremont Hills is about two miles to the west, on Highway CC. Triple S. Properties is led by Mike Seitz, a residential and commercial real estate developer since 1990, and Morelock Builders is led by Wayne Morelock, who co-founded Morelock-Ross Builders Inc. in 1982 and now runs the surviving company after partner Kenny Ross left in 2018.
